Let’s Make it Together
Prepare Your Ingredients: Start by washing and chopping all your vegetables into bite-sized pieces. The colorful mix will not only look beautiful but also provide wonderful textures.
Add Everything to the Crockpot: Place the chicken breasts at the bottom of the crockpot. Layer in carrots, celery, onion, garlic, thyme, salt, and pepper over the top. It’s like building a warm hug of flavors.
Pour in Chicken Broth: Carefully pour enough broth over everything until it’s just covered. This liquid gold will transform into deliciousness as it simmers throughout the day.
Set It and Forget It!: Cover your crockpot with its lid and set it on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ours. Go about your day while your kitchen fills with an irresistible aroma!
Shred Chicken and Finishing Touches : Once cooked through, remove chicken breasts using tongs or forks. Shred them into bite-sized pieces before returning them to the pot along with lemon juice.
Savor Every Spoonful!: Ladle into bowls while still hot and enjoy every comforting bite! Serve with crusty bread or crackers if desired – because who doesn’t love dipping?

FAQ
Can I use frozen chicken in this crockpot chicken soup?
Yes, frozen chicken can be used; just ensure it cooks thoroughly before serving.
How long should I cook the soup on low?
Cook the soup on low heat for about 6-8 hours for best results.

Crockpot Chicken Soup

Ingredients
- 3–4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 1.5 lbs)
- 2 cups diced carrots
- 2 cups diced celery
- 1 medium onion, finely chopped
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 6 cups low-sodium chicken broth
- 1 tsp dried thyme (or 1 tbsp fresh thyme)
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Juice of 1 lemon
Instructions
- Prepare the vegetables by washing and chopping them into bite-sized pieces.
- Place the chicken breasts at the bottom of the crockpot and layer with carrots, celery, onion, garlic, thyme, salt, and pepper.
- Pour in enough chicken broth to cover the ingredients.
-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ours.
- Once cooked, shred the chicken with tongs or forks and return it to the pot along with lemon juice.
- Serve hot in bowls with crusty bread or crackers.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 6–8 hours
- Category: Main
- Method: Slow Cooking
